Behavioral engagement
Learning activities involved in academic settings.
Emotional engagement
How much students like their school.
Cognitive engagement
A self-regulated approach where students push themselves in their learning.
Motivation to do school
Predicts academic performance; low motivation causes further declines.
Choice Matters
Success does not equal enjoyment, but having choices increases motivation.
Goal orientation
Performance (outcome) vs. mastery (learning) goal orientation.
Expectations for success
Belief in one's capabilities positively predicts grades/performance.
Test anxiety
Affects performance through worry and negative emotions.
Task value
Subjective value assigned to a task, influenced by interest and emotional stress.
Parenting context
Providing emotional warmth, support, information, and guidance.
Peers context
Assist one another in academic efforts.
Bidirectional (Peer context)
Peer similarity in academic engagement influences performance, positively or negatively.
Entity orientation
Fixed mindset where abilities are seen as innate.
Incremental/mastery orientation
Belief that skills can improve over time, not fixed.
